EDL Exporting Inaccurate Timecode

Explorer ,
Apr 01, 2024 Apr 01, 2024

Hey all,

 

Running into an issue in 24.3.0 where exporting an EDL with transitions enabled is throwing off the timecode while turning off that setting in the EDL export gives a correct EDL. I have set the indeterminate framerate setting to match the timeline (23.976 in this case). We are using this EDL to communicate cut points to a colorist who is working with an XQ render of this project. We are trying an XML for now but it's frustrating to have a basic function like EDL export completely inaccurate.

 

I have a screenshot below of our EDL settings attached as well as a screenshot of the two EDLs in TextEdit. You can see the timecodes shifting when it hits the transition which throws off the clip after it. 

 

Working on an Mac Studio M1 Ultra with OS X 14.4

Premiere 24.3.0

Hey Bruce, I have recreated the problem with another project and it seems to be tied to having 24p clips in a 23.976 timeline. When the timeline was 24p it had no issues. Please let me know what you find with this,
